    Clyde is such a set of contrasts:

    1. He looked so old out there, yet dunks almost effortlessly and truly unlike anyone else with his slow-motion hang time
    2. His coast-to-coast dribbling where he would put his head down and just blow past everyone, yet still looked like he was in slow-motion. Very odd, yet it worked all the time.
    3. Have you ever tried a jump-shot like Clyde does it? Jump up high, bring your feet underneath you, then shoot a line drive. Degree of difficulty 10, yet he looks effortless in doing it.
    4. Has to have the highest velocity on free throws - i.e. the ball's speed. No loft whatsoever. Yet was a good free throw shooter.
    5. He always looked so serious and focused on the court, yet on the Rockets broadcasts, he sounds like a goofball.

    One of my favorite players of all-time.

    Clyde did whatever was needed. I don't think people realize Clyde played the 4 his first two years at UH, and he didn't slide down to the 3 until Dream moved into the starting lineup his junior year. He also was the point man when they went against teams that tried to run full court presses on them. He was just a swiss army knife of a player he could do pretty much everything on the court.
